  24 /* @test
  25  * @bug 6827800
  26  * @summary Test to check hidden default button does not respond to 'Enter' key
  27  * @run main HiddenDefaultButtonTest
  28  */
  29 
  30 import java.awt.AWTException;
  31 import java.awt.Robot;
  32 import java.awt.event.ActionListener;
  33 import java.awt.event.ActionEvent;
  34 import java.awt.event.KeyEvent;
  35 import javax.swing.JButton;
  36 import javax.swing.JFrame;
  37 import javax.swing.SwingUtilities;
  38 
  39 public class HiddenDefaultButtonTest {
  40 
  41     private static int ButtonClickCount = 0;
  42     private static JFrame frame;
  43 
  44     private static void createGUI() {
  45         frame = new JFrame();
  46         frame.setD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E);
  47 
  48         JButton button = new JButton("Default button");
  49         button.setDefaultCapable(true);
  50         button.addActionListener(new ActionListener() {
  51             public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ent e) {
  52                 ButtonClickCount++;
  53             }
  54         });
  55 
  56         frame.add(button);
  57         button.setVisible(false);
  58 
  59         frame.getRootPane().setDefaultButton(button);
  60 
  61         frame.setSize(200, 200);
  62         frame.setLocationRelativeTo(null);
  63         frame.setVisible(true);
  64     }
  65 
  66     private static void disposeTestUI() throws Exception {
  67         SwingUtilities.invokeAndWait(() -> {
  68             frame.dispose();
  69         });
  70     }
  71 
  72     private static void test() throws Exception {
  73         // Create Robot
  74         Robot testRobot = new Robot();
  75 
  76         testRobot.waitForIdle();
  77 
  78         testRobot.keyPress(KeyEvent.VK_ENTER);
  79         testRobot.delay(20);
  80         testRobot.keyRelease(KeyEvent.VK_ENTER);
  81         testRobot.delay(200);
  82         testRobot.keyPress(KeyEvent.VK_ENTER);
  83         testRobot.delay(20);
  84         testRobot.keyRelease(KeyEvent.VK_ENTER);
  85 
  86         testRobot.waitForIdle();
  87 
  88         if (ButtonClickCount != 0) {
  89             disposeTestUI();
  90             throw new RuntimeException("DefaultButton is pressed even if it is invisible");
  91         }
  92 
  93     }
  94 
  95     public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
  96         // create UI
  97         SwingUtilities.invokeAndWait(new Runnable() {
  98             public void run() {
  99                 HiddenDefaultButtonTest.createGUI();
 100             }
 101         });
 102 
 103         // Test default button press by pressing EnterKey using Robot
 104         test();
 105 
 106         // dispose UI
 107         HiddenDefaultButtonTest.disposeTestUI();
 108     }
 109 }
